How to watch F1 on ORF for free
ORF TV is free to watch, and it will broadcast 14 of the 24 Formula 1 Grands Prix this season. If you’re not by the TV on a race day, you can stream the entire race weekend live on the free ORF ON app. The app is available for computers, mobile devices, and some smart TVs and TV box systems.

Other ways to watch F1 in Austria
ServusTV shares the Formula 1 broadcast rights with ORF. It has the exclusive rights to 10 Grands Prix and will simulcast the Austrian Grand Prix live stream along with ORF.
You can watch in your browser or through the ServusTV ON app for mobile devices and select smart TVs and TV box systems.

2025 ORF F1 schedule
Race | Date | Venue |
Chinese GP | March 21–23, 2025 | Shanghai International Circuit |
Japanese GP | April 4–6, 2025 | Suzuka International Racing Course |
Saudi Arabian GP | April 18–20, 2025 | Jeddah Corniche Circuit |
Miami GP | May 2–4, 2025 | Miami International Autodrome |
Emilia Romagna GP | May 16–18, 2025 | Imola |
Spanish GP | May 30–June 1, 2025 | Circuit de Catalunya |
Austrian GP | June 27 –29, 2025 | Red Bull Ring |
British GP | July 4–6, 2025 | Silverstone |
Hungarian GP | August 1–3, 2025 | Hungaroring |
Italian GP | September 5–7, 2025 | Monza |
Azerbaijan GP | September 19–21, 2025 | Baku City Circuit |
Mexican GP | October 24–26, 2025 | Autodrome Hermanos Rodriguez |
Qatar GP | November 28–30, 2025 | Losail International Circuit |
Abu Dhabi GP | December 5–7, 2025 | Yas Marina |

Where can I watch F1 races for free?
Belgian fans can live stream every F1 race for free with French commentary on RTBF, while fans in Austria can watch for free on ORF and ServusTV with German commentary. The only way to watch F1 for free in the U.S. is with a free trial of YouTube TV.
What channels are F1 races available on?
In Austria, you can stream every Formula 1 Grand Prix race for free, with 14 races on ORF and 11 on ServusTV. In Belgium, RTBF shows every race weekend for free with French commentary.
Other options include ABC, ESPN, and ESPN2 (available through Sling, YouTube TV, and Hulu + Live TV in the U.S.); Sky Sports F1 (available through NOW and Sky Sports in the UK), Fox Sports (available through Kayo Sports and Foxtel Now in Australia), and Viaplay (Nordic countries and the Netherlands).

What TV channel is F1 on in Spain?
DAZN has the exclusive broadcast and streaming rights for Formula 1 until the end of the 2026 season.
How can I watch F1 without Sky?
UK residents looking to watch Formula 1 races without subscribing directly to Sky Sports can catch every F1 Grand Prix on NOW. The platform offers a day pass, which is convenient if you only want to watch a race from time to time without a long-term commitment.
